当前位置: 首页 > 香港vps服务器 >

论Tengine从Web代理服务器到分布式推送服务器的演

时间:2020-07-26 来源:未知 作者:admin   分类:香港vps服务器

  • 正文

  无论客户端倡议的请求是 HTTP2 仍是 HTTP 1.1,营业 Hold 住 HTTP 的请求,B 凡是单体使用,且 QPS 与端的数量成线、较长间隔的轮询请求,一个长毗连但愿可以或许接管多个推送动静,推送是照顾对应的的 Key 以暗示本人期望推送至哪个毗连凡是。

  无论在哪个环节,1、使用往 Tengine 集群随机一台机械推送,而往往推送场景的利用者均是超大规模的终端设备,多次推送数据都能有明白的分界线,利用 multipart/form-data ,下面是具体流程如下:Tengine 对 每个 TCP 毗连生成一个 key(也能够利用请求 Header 等作为 Key ),即,而且在需要时?

Tengine 作为代办署理办事器,有着 高机能、低延迟、高可用 等特征。这是最简单且最容易想到的手段,使用需要本人该长毗连的生命周期,由 Tengine 来做分布式由。Tengine 依托其丰硕的 HTTP 处置能力,写同学的作文即由多个微办事构成,在核心化存储中保留 key 和对应机械ip的映照消息。无论客户端倡议的是 HTTP 仍是HTTP2,Tengine 担任和客户端进行长毗连的保活、和使用办事器使器具体负载平衡算法进行短毗连安排。错误谬误很较着,从 摆设在 使用单机上的 Tengine ,2、Sc 收到 推送动静,能够说集团几乎所有使用机械均运转着 Tengine 。在 Tair 中查找对应请求由哪台 Tengine 机械,只是用 HTTP 来实现罢了,这都得益于Tengine 作为优良的反向代办署理办事器,

现实上 HTTP2 的推送功能指的是单个 request 有多个 response ,如下图所示:1、较短间隔的轮询请求会导致 Server 端的处置无用的 QPS ,明显需要晓得 A 在 Tengine 集群中的哪台机械,其感化也不经不异,故B使用中,使用只需要往Tengine集群的肆意一台机械推送数据,而不是一个推送动静竣事后再次新建,Tengine 作为反向代办署理办事器,当然,主持婚庆。客户端只需单个毗连,转发机能是业界的标杆,到作为集群式摆设的同一接入 Aserver ,是的推送数据具有明白的 boundary ,下图从推送角度描述了 Tengine 若何工作。ssr套餐购买香港云服务器推荐Tengine 本身支撑多种和谈,在集团有着普遍的使用根本,但往往也是在现实项目中最不成能利用的方案。议论文作文!例如查找到该推送目标毗连在 Sb 。由于其错误谬误很是较着:现实上和 MQTT 的 SUB PUB 模式很是类似。

  Tengine 作为反向代办署理办事器只完成根基的转发能力,和使用办事器之间均是短毗连(除非 Tengine 设置装备摆设 keepalive ),与我们长毗连通道持续传输数据的需求不婚配。就能获得多次推送数据。我们在Tengine转发流程插手了 核心化存储能力使得 Tengine 有了分布式由的功能。至多某个微办事需要由核心化存储(例如 redis、memcache )来决定将请求发送至哪台 Tengine 。其推送时效性无法Tengine 本身作为代办署理办事器,均能承继上述推送功能。对其进行 response 。Tengine 的分歧摆设形态。

(责任编辑:admin)